Barbel330 wrote: Fri Jun 28, 2019 8:43 am

I’d definitely trim the duct rather than cutting up the adblue tank. Then matt black the tank where it’s visible through the duct if it’s not already black.

You could gently heat the tank up in the offending area and carefully reshape it but it’s risky and it would need to be empty.
Ah some good ideas there. Thanks! I’d not considered those

Unfortunately the tanks don’t come cheap some I’m swaying away from fiddling with it

For 60 quid and a bit of a stab it’s worth trimming the ducts down first. Gonna attack it with the grinder at the wk end 👍🏻
